HILLBILLY CAKE 
2 eggs
1 can (No. 2) pineapple
2 c. flour
1 tsp. baking soda
1/8 tsp. salt
1 1/2 c. sugar
1 c. coconut

Mix eggs and pineapple and set aside. Combine flour, soda, salt and sugar and mix together. Combine eggs and pineapple. Pour into 9x13x2 inch pan and top with coconut. Bake at 350 degrees for 45 minutes.

TOPPING:

1 c. milk
1 c. sugar
1 stick butter

Combine milk, sugar and butter and boil for 3 minutes. Punch holes in top of cake with fork and spoon frosting over top.

I changed the topping. I used coconut milk instead of milk and added the sugar and butter as directed. It was richer and really good. You need to use the right sized dish as specified, not too small, because when you poke the holes in the top there's quite a bit of topping that needs to be absorbed. The right sized pan is fine but too small turns it soggy.
